    I’m not entirely sure how I functioned without KT tape before. This is a wonderful alternative to bulky braces. If you have any adhesive allergy, like me, I highly recommend starting with skin prep, then laying cover roll over the adhesion area, finishing with KT tape. I’m a big believer in preventative practices but when you have an acute injury, this stuff is miraculous. Their website has a thorough list of videos for various tapings that you can adjust for your needs.

    Ive tried several different kinesiology tapes, here are the results of my head-to-head comparisons... In order of stretchiness: KT Tape Pro: Super stretchy spandex-type material. Dries super fast. Breathes excellently even in multiple layers. KT Tape: High-elastic content cotton. Dries reasonably fast. Adequate breathability in multiple layers. Rocktape H2O: High-elastic content cotton. Dries reasonably fast. Adequate breathability in multiple layers. Rocktape: Moderate-elastic content cotton. Takes the longest to dry but thats still fast. Not very breathable, can feel slightly stifling in multiple layers. In order of stickiness: Rocktape H2O: Can be repositioned, and will stick just as well after repositioning. Sticks to tape well. Can be uncomfortable to remove. Rocktape: Can be repositioned, but loses some stickiness each time. Edges tend to peel up. Doesnt stick to tape very well. Okay removal. KT Tape Pro: Can be repositioned, but wont stick for more than a day if you do. Sticks to tape well. Easily removed. KT Tape: Cannot be repositioned, edges tend to peel. Sticks to tape adequately well. Seems more painful to remove than others. In order of longevity: Rocktape H2O: 3+ days. Stays put until you take it off. KT Tape Pro: 2-4 days. Once you get it stuck on, it stays. Less peeling than Rocktape. Rocktape: 2-4 days. Edges tend to peel up on day 2, so youve got to trim it down. KT Tape: 1 day. Edges and entire parts of strips peel up almost immediately. In order of support: Rocktape: Very stable support. Multiple layers offer similar support to a lightly structured brace. Useful for areas where you need a lot of stability like knees and ankles. Rocktape H2O: Stable support. Multiple layers offer similar support to a soft compression brace. Useful for areas where you need both stretch and support, better adhesion and superior stretch offers excellent massage for sore muscles. KT Tape: Moderately stable support. Multiple layers offer similar support to a compression sleeve. KT Tape Pro: Light to moderate support. Multiple layers offer similar support to a soft compression sleeve. Useful for areas where you need flexibility first, particularly well-suited to wrists and fingers.
